How to Prevent a Roach Infestation

1. Clean Your Kitchen

Roaches tend to enter homes or businesses where they can find food sources. So if you have greasy appliances or crumbs on your floors or pantry shelves, it could attract those critters. Vacuum and clean all the surfaces in your kitchen regularly to eliminate those food traces. Additionally, keep leftover food in sealed plastic containers.

2. Seal Off Cracks & Openings

roach control servicesRoaches can sneak into your home through tiny cracks or openings. Go through your house, particularly along the outer walls, and find any gaps or areas that need to be sealed. Then caulk over them or seal them in some other way.
